Feature Overview
The FMM003 is an OBD plug‑and‑play tracker designed for fleet use, combining cellular connectivity options with vehicle parameter reading and a set of built‑in event detections. It focuses on delivering location, vehicle state, and event visibility while simplifying installation via the OBD‑II interface.
- OBD OEM parameter reading for odometer and fuel level reporting to improve fleet monitoring accuracy
- Cellular connectivity with LTE Cat M1 and NB IoT plus fallback to 2G for wide area coverage
- Multi‑constellation GNSS support for robust positioning in varied environments
- Compact plug‑and‑play OBD‑II installation for fast deployment in compatible vehicles
- Built‑in event detections such as overspeed, towing, unplug, crash, excessive idling, and jamming detection
- Local data storage capability for temporary buffering when cellular is unavailable

Feature Availability Notes
- OBD parameter availability depends on the vehicle make, model, and the manufacturer OEM parameter list supported by the device
- Some detections and telemetry rely on specific firmware capabilities and may change across firmware or hardware revisions
- Cellular behavior and coverage depend on local operator support for LTE Cat M1 and NB IoT in your region and device SIM configuration
- Installation type and physical access to the OBD‑II port can affect which parameters are available and how reliably the device reports
- Confirm supported vehicle models and parameter lists with the official Teltonika supported vehicle information and by testing on the target vehicles
